首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

安装mysql后总是闪退

MySQL闪退可能有多种原因,以下是一些基础概念、常见问题及其解决方法:

基础概念

MySQL是一个关系型数据库管理系统,广泛用于Web应用和其他需要存储和检索数据的应用程序。它支持多种操作系统,并且有社区版和企业版两种版本。

常见问题及解决方法

1. 配置文件问题

MySQL的配置文件(通常是my.cnfmy.ini)可能包含错误的配置,导致MySQL无法启动。

解决方法:

  • 检查配置文件中的路径是否正确。
  • 确保配置文件中没有语法错误。
  • 可以尝试使用默认的配置文件进行启动。

2. 端口冲突

MySQL默认使用3306端口,如果该端口已被其他程序占用,MySQL将无法启动。

解决方法:

  • 检查是否有其他程序占用了3306端口。
  • 可以修改MySQL的配置文件,将端口改为其他未被占用的端口。

3. 数据库文件损坏

MySQL的数据文件(如ibdata1)可能损坏,导致MySQL无法启动。

解决方法:

  • 尝试使用mysqlcheck工具进行修复。
  • 如果数据文件严重损坏,可能需要从备份中恢复数据。

4. 内存不足

如果系统内存不足,MySQL可能无法启动。

解决方法:

  • 增加系统内存。
  • 调整MySQL的内存配置参数,如innodb_buffer_pool_size

5. 权限问题

MySQL的安装目录或数据目录的权限设置不正确,可能导致MySQL无法启动。

解决方法:

  • 确保MySQL的安装目录和数据目录有正确的读写权限。
  • 确保MySQL服务以正确的用户身份运行。

示例代码

以下是一个简单的示例,展示如何检查和修改MySQL的配置文件:

代码语言:txt
复制
# 检查MySQL配置文件
cat /etc/my.cnf

# 修改MySQL配置文件
sudo nano /etc/my.cnf

# 修改端口为3307
[mysqld]
port=3307

# 保存并退出
sudo systemctl restart mysql

参考链接

通过以上方法,您可以逐步排查并解决MySQL闪退的问题。如果问题依然存在,建议查看MySQL的错误日志,通常位于/var/log/mysql/error.log,以获取更多详细的错误信息。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• docker启动mysql失败(闪退)原因

    创建好mysql之后容器之后可以连接 后来修改了配置发现mysql启动不了 docker ps -a 查看发现mysql的状态一直是EXIST docker start mysql 能成功启动(docker...返回mysql) 但是再查看docker ps发现还是没有启动起来 大概可以知道就是docker启动之后又迅速关闭 想起Docker容器后台运行,就必须有一个前台进程。...否则就会自动关闭,大概推测是docker里的mysql没又起起来。 想起刚刚修改了配置,可能是配置错了导致的。...一看发现粘贴配置的时候格式乱了 调整后保存 即可启动 版权声明:本文内容由互联网用户自发贡献,该文观点仅代表作者本人。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。

    4.4K30

    labelimg安装和使用(解决闪退问题)

    二、下载方法 1.注意: 2.安装Anaconda3 1.打开 2.下载 3.安装 三.安装环境和labelimg 四.使用labelimg 前言 在计算机视觉的具体领域中我们会使用到深度学习,深度学习的模型需要基于图片来进行训练...3.均可以按照以下步骤平稳的使用labeling 2.安装Anaconda3 1.打开 Index of /anaconda/archive/ | 清华大学开源软件镜像站 | Tsinghua Open...Source Mirror 2.下载 anaconda3-2023.07-1-windows-x86_64.exe 3.安装 强调: advanced options中全选√ 默认安装路径在c盘,为了不出现其他问题...,建议安装在c盘 三.安装环境和labelimg 具体位置在安装的路径 输入 conda create -n python39 python=3.9.16进行安装 如果遇到y或n选y(原环境).../simple 四.安装成功并出现 四.使用labelimg 图片打开路径和图片保存路径 这样我们就可以愉快的进行标注喽,按照这种流程下来的话,不会出现闪退的问题!

    2.2K10

    macOS安装Parallels Desktop 14闪退的解决办法

    首先要说明一点,如果你的电脑之前没有安装过Xcode,那么请先在终端执行命令 xcode-select --install 然后接下来所有的下载和安装都是自动完成的,安装完Xcode以后再按照本贴里提供的...Parallels Desktop虚拟机的安装教程来逐步完成操作。...如果你的电脑之前有安装过Xcode,可忽略这一步而继续进行下面的操作。...Parallels Desktop文件夹中 "Parallels Desktop"显示出来了(这个在第三个打开的盘符中,将窗口最大化就看到了) 把它拖到 "Applications"(应用程序)里去,若之前安装过则会提示是否覆盖...再执行 codesign --sign - --force --deep /Applications/Parallels\ Desktop.app/ 然后双击 Parallels Desktop.app 安装即可

    3.6K20

    MySql闪退和服务无法启动的解决方法

    接触php那么久,但是安装环境却很生疏,遇到了很多问题,借着百度,整理了些下面的方法 问题一:mysql服务没有安装 解决办法: 在cmd操作下找到mysql的安装目录(注意要用管理员身份运行cmd)...在 mysql bin目录下 以管理员的权限 执行 mysqld -install命令 然后仍然以管理员的权限 net start mysql 开启Mysql服务了。...1、以管理员的权限 net stop mysql ,关闭mysql服务 2、以管理员的权限 mysqld -remove ,卸载mysql服务 报错: 信息如下: Install/Remove of the...用管理员身份打开后,开启服务,但还是不能运行 问题三:服务无法启动 用mysqld -console输出了错误信息,有一条错误信息是data目录下没有mysql文件夹 解决办法: 执行mysqld –...initialize初始化data目录 这几个问题处理之后,mysql正常启动了 问题四:密码错误 密码错误,也会造成cmd闪退

    3K20

    mysql启动后自动停止_宝塔mysql总是自动停止解决方法总汇

    当然导致这种问题除了服务器配置不够还跟你设置不当所导致有关,比如MySQL、php等性能设置!当然今天讨论的主题并不是这。...出现数据库经常停止可以参照下面解决方案: 解决方法一: 安装宝塔面板【linux工具箱】 添加设置SWAP大小,根据你的实际内存进行调整,swap是Linux下的虚拟内存,设置适当的swap可增加服务器稳定性...登陆宝塔后台-计划任务-添加Mysql守护,执行周期,可选择多长时间执行一次,比如10分钟监控执行一次,具体的周期请站长根据自己服务器实际情况来设置。...-ne 0 ] echo At time:$(date) :MySQL is stop . .../var/log/mysql_messages service mysqld start fi 执行周期我设置的1分钟检测一次,也就当你数据库停止后,1分钟会重启,网站可以正常访问了!

    7.9K10

    Windows10系统安装solidworks2016后使用激活工具注册机闪退或卡死不动解决方法总结

    最近帮朋友装了个Solidworks2016版本的,按照安装教程给出的步骤一步一步走下来都没问题,到最后使用激活工具激活的时候,一直闪退,然后查了查资料,挨个方法都试了没有用,最后发现是自己的问题,必须耐心等...2.将破解工具(SW2010-2016.Activator.GUI.SSQ.exe)挪到桌面运行,最好挪到solidworks安装的文件夹进行破解。...3.找到C盘里面的隐藏文件ProgramData→FLEXnet→SW_D_00481b00_tsf.data和SW_D_00481b00_tsf.data_backup,将两个文件删除后破解,如何查看隐藏文件自行百度一下...8.最后这个比较重要,就是关于运行环境,要把net framework 3.5打开后再破解。...最后再说一下,如果显示未响应,或者没反应,但是鼠标哪里在转圈圈,建议一定要等,因为solidworks毕竟10个G呢,所以耐心等待一会,如果十分钟后还没反应,那就付费找人解决吧。

    38.2K10
    领券